alignment
appears in 4 paper titles
Definition
Making a model's behaviour conform to human intent, values, or a specified set of norms — refusing harmful requests, following the spirit of an instruction rather than gaming its letter. RLHF, constitutional methods, and preference optimization are all alignment techniques. Note a separate, unrelated technical sense of the word: in multimodal and translation work, alignment means putting two representations or sequences into correspondence.
